Output 0839912f3aafcccf2e40922bb3f9f2c5781e30828d2540bb22faf77dc386fe0e:0

value
48863244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ec83a627c815a59430537b19f0cf8b4763ce4b6 OP_EQUAL
address
3ALBJfZcfuU8fugyVqeGSntXkR5pmyxLh9
transaction
0839912f3aafcccf2e40922bb3f9f2c5781e30828d2540bb22faf77dc386fe0e
confirmations
366215
spent
true